## Formula sandbox tuning

User-supplied formulas in Gridmoor execute inside a restricted interpreter with hard ceilings on time, memory, and call depth. Reviewers should confirm any change to these ceilings is justified in the PR description, since raising them widens the abuse surface. Defaults were chosen from production traces. The current limits are as follows.

limits module of tafog-fawip:
WEIGHTS = {
    "julix": 57,
    "lamys": 992,
    "kasvan": 209,
    "quenok": 750,
    "alddor": 259,
    "oliath": 1009,
    "wenix": 815,
}

Ticket #8852 — Intern cohort arrival, Hollybeck Campus

Fourteen interns from the Fernlight programme arrive Monday 08:30. Contractors working in the atrium: clear tools and cabling from the main stairwell by Friday evening. The cohort will tour floors 1–3; keep fire routes unobstructed throughout. Temporary signage goes up Sunday.

Contractors needing early access that morning should use the service-door code below.

door code, tagef-bajop: bdg-SB-7

## Releases

The Brindlekit component library follows semantic versioning. Patch releases ship weekly; minor releases require sign-off from the Marleyford platform team. Tags are cut from the release branch only, never from main. Every published package is signed before it reaches the internal registry, and CI will reject any artifact whose signature does not verify. If you are setting up a local publish environment, verify your builds against the current release signing key shown below.

deploy key for kajof-yawif: bky9_fvxrpdHPq

## Changelog — Squatwatch 3.2

Default scan behavior changed. Squatwatch now quarantines suspected typo-squatting packages automatically instead of only flagging them, and the edit-distance threshold dropped from 2 to 1 to cut false positives. On-call: expect fewer noisy alerts but occasional quarantine appeals; the override queue is in the admin panel. Legacy allowlists still apply. The new default configuration is listed below.

settings of fafog-yajof:
ulaael:
  log_level: warn
  metrics_host: metrics.ulaael.zemvarlabs.internal
  pin: 7979
  pool_size: 32